1996 NASA Agencywide Employee & Customer Satisfaction Survey Results: NASA Headquarters
1996 NASA Agencywide Employee & Customer Satisfaction Survey Results: NASA Headquarters
Total Response: 310
Last update 2 November 1996.
Note: The following questionnaire was distributed to NASA employees on/around 22 August 1996 as an enclosure to a letter from Acting Deputy Administrator Jack Dailey.

7) How consistent does NASA operate in accordance with the following values from the strategic plan?
Very Consistent | Somewhat Consistent | Neither Consistent Nor Inconsistent | Somewhat Inconsistent | Very Inconsistent | |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Our greatest strength is our workforce | 4.2 | 13.3 | 7.8 | 27.3 | 47.4 |
We empower our employees | 1.9 | 21.0 | 9.1 | 34.6 | 33.3 |
We encourage and reward creativity | 4.6 | 25.1 | 17.9 | 28.0 | 24.4 |
We encourage and reward teamwork | 6.5 | 29.3 | 20.2 | 22.8 | 21.2 |
We foster a culture built on trust | 0.7 | 8.8 | 11.1 | 26.1 | 53.4 |
We foster a culture built upon respect | 2.6 | 14.7 | 13.7 | 25.8 | 43.1 |
We build a team representative of America’s diversity | 10.5 | 40.5 | 19.9 | 14.4 | 14.7 |
We cooperate across organizations | 3.3 | 28.7 | 17.6 | 30.0 | 20.5 |
We are open and honest with one another | 1.3 | 14.9 | 17.5 | 32.7 | 33.7 |
We are open and honest with our customers | 5.8 | 34.7 | 20.8 | 21.4 | 17.2 |
We are accountable for our performance | 14.6 | 35.9 | 17.5 | 16.8 | 14.9 |
8) Please indicate the extent to which you agree with the following statements:
Agree Completely | Agree Somewhat | Neither Agree nor Disagree | Disagree Somewhat | Disagree Completely | |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
I am optimistic about NASA’s future | 9.6 | 30.4 | 7.7 | 31.0 | 21.4 |
Agency senior management can be expected to do the right thing | 2.6 | 18.2 | 11.5 | 37.5 | 30.4 |
Once a decision is made, management communicates the results and rationale to employees | 2.2 | 17.6 | 15.1 | 38.8 | 26.3 |
Innovation in NASA is appreciated and supported | 6.1 | 32.9 | 23.3 | 21.1 | 16.6 |
There is a willingness to accept responsibility for failure | 1.6 | 24.1 | 20.6 | 30.2 | 23.5 |
NASA centers work effectively together to accomplish NASA’s mission | 1.9 | 17.4 | 19.3 | 37.0 | 24.4 |
Trust is the norm across work units | 1.0 | 15.3 | 21.3 | 36.6 | 25.8 |
Trust is the norm within work units | 7.4 | 41.2 | 17.7 | 19.6 | 14.1 |
Employees can say what is right without fear of reprimand from management | 3.8 | 13.8 | 16.3 | 29.5 | 36.5 |
I feel free to speak my mind | 16.6 | 22.0 | 12.5 | 25.2 | 23.6 |

20) Listed below are potential barriers that may prevent your work
unit from providing the best in customer service. For each item,
indicate how much of a problem this is for your work unit in
performing its job.
Not a problem | A Minor Problem | A Major Problem | |
---|---|---|---|
Lack of skilled personnel | 43.6 | 33.7 | 22.8 |
Lack of financial resources | 37.9 | 28.4 | 8.0 |
Lack of physical resources | 63.6 | 28.4 | 8.0 |
Inflexible management | 40.7 | 37.5 | 21.8 |
Inconsistent management | 27.0 | 37.0 | 36.0 |
Lack of staff involvement in decision making | 35.7 | 36.0 | 28.3 |
Unreasonable customer demands | 49.5 | 41.8 | 8.7 |
Lack of day-to-day employee recognition | 44.6 | 34.6 | 20.8 |
Overly bureaucratic laws, systems, and practices | 26.3 | 45.2 | 28.5 |
Lack of information from management officials | 22.8 | 47.1 | 30.1 |
Over dependence on contractors | 73.0 | 16.7 | 10.3 |
Lack of teamwork within organizational units | 41.9 | 40.6 | 17.6 |
Lack of teamwork among organizational units | 23.5 | 50.8 | 25.7 |
Lack of control over suppliers | 71.4 | 23.2 | 5.5 |
Limited opportunities for education & training | 64.5 | 25.9 | 9.6 |
Inability to market programs and/or services | 65.9 | 27.6 | 6.5 |
Organizational instability | 14.7 | 30.7 | 54.6 |
Lack of customer satisfaction data | 57.7 | 32.1 | 10.3 |
Lack of customer service standards | 57.4 | 31.0 | 11.6 |
Lack of time | 24.7 | 44.6 | 30.8 |
